Not really mountains like you're used to. These are more like foot hills than mountains. Let me put it this way... you can walk to the top of Brasstown Bald, the highest mountain in Georgia, in about 20 minutes from the gift shop and parking lot near the summit.





Come to think of it, Brasstown Bald is a great place to ride to from Suches. The view is as good as you'll see in all of Georgia on a clear day.

The official days of the event are Friday-Sunday.
I live near by, so taking off extra days is for me to get ready, get there, and get set-up.
Friday is getting everything together, and in the afternoon/evening is a non-formal Meet and Greet. Usually a bonfire in the back, with lots going on in the lodge as well.
Saturday, are the Buell demo rides from 7:00 to 4:00. Also on Saturday are informal rides with the 3%ers. The same goes for Sunday.
All weekend there will be riding, and partying.
Saturday, I plan on having a BadWeB tent set up so we can get together and put a name with a face. I plan on having it going from morning until 2:00 or so.
The whole event, you're pretty much left up to your own devises, there are so many people, and miles of the best twisties, that you'll not get bored.

Bring a map of the area so you can explore on your own (if you want). There will be scores of informal guided rides going on all weekend, too. Pick a group you are comfortable with and make as many friends as you can. You'll meet so many people, you'll have a hard time remembering names.

I usually spend one day demoing the bikes and meeting people at the campground, then I spend one day riding hard and exploring.
